    Peter Parker’s past collides with his future! Can Peter Parker save his family and himself?! Webhead stalwart Marc Guggenheim and rising star Marco Chechetto (AMAZING SPIDER-MAN: AMERICAN SON) bring you the rollicking conclusion of “WHO WAS BEN REILLY?”

    THIS IS THE FINAL CHAPTER IN THE "WHO WAS BEN REILLY?" STORY ARC. I REALLY ENJOYED THIS ARC. I LOVE THAT SPIDEYS CLONE KAINE IS FINALLY BEING USED AGAIN. IN THIS ISSUE YOU FIND OUT THAT DAMON RYDER(RAPTOR) WAS THE CAUSE OF HIS FAMILIES DEATH NOT REILLY. A FIGHT BREAKS OUT BETWEEN SPIDEY AND RAPTOR AND KAINE AND EVEN SCREWBALL IN THE HOME OF MAY PARKER.
